From 041122c85ddf8609ce3ccb7920de4b3f3cd1ac6e Mon Sep 17 00:00:00 2001 From: George Joseph Date: Fri, 15 Dec 2023 09:37:54 -0700 Subject: [PATCH] res_rtp_asterisk: Fix regression issues with DTLS client check * Since ICE candidates are used for the check and pjproject is required to use ICE, res_rtp_asterisk was failing to compile when pjproject wasn't available. The check is now wrapped with an #ifdef HAVE_PJPROJECT. * The rtp->ice_active_remote_candidates container was being used to check the address on incoming packets but that container doesn't contain peer reflexive candidates discovered during negotiation. This was causing the check to fail where it shouldn't. We now check against pjproject's real_ice->rcand array which will contain those candidates. * Also fixed a bug in ast_sockaddr_from_pj_sockaddr() where we weren't zeroing out sin->sin_zero before returning. This was causing ast_sockaddr_cmp() to always return false when one of the inputs was converted from a pj_sockaddr, even if both inputs had the same address and port.
